Output 30f7ddd742a073419f379d8526736c1b13476569c48689b0a6cfccacbd7bfeb7:3

value
5536000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 847daae9b5d1336d859b6285d5ca22fab4321c9e OP_EQUAL
address
3DmZfQTcqDFMrdrx86H4wP4LNwBE8J1X4e
transaction
30f7ddd742a073419f379d8526736c1b13476569c48689b0a6cfccacbd7bfeb7
spent
true